Forget the grand slam -- 2 key challenges lead Mariners to victory (opens original article in a new tab)

TL;DR

The Mariners won 6-3 against the Orioles, with two key challenges overturning initial calls that affected the game's outcome.

  • Backup catcher Jhonny Pereda's challenge overturned a full-count walk to Pete Alonso into a strikeout.
  • A traditional challenge by the Mariners eliminated a scoring tag by Jackson Holliday, leading to a double play.
  • Mariners' bullpen faced struggles but managed to secure a 10th save by Andrés Muñoz.
